Minimum PC Specs to Run Android Apps on Windows 11 Revealed

The minimum PC specs for running Android apps on Windows 11 are higher than the requirements for Windows. A computer with at least 8GB of RAM and an SSD is required, although 16GB is preferred. In addition, the operating system must enable the Virtual Machine Platform, which can be found in the Control Panel. You can enable this feature to run any Android application on your PC. Minimum PC requirements to install Android apps on Windows 11

Microsoft has shared the following minimum requirements needed for your PC to run Android apps on Windows 11:

  • RAM: 8 GB (minimum) | 16 GB (recommended)
  • Storage type: Solid State Drive (SSD)
  • Processor: Intel Core i3 8th Gen (minimum) or above, AMD Ryzen 3000 (minimum) or above, Qualcomm Snapdragon 8c (minimum) or above
  • Processor architecture: x64 or ARM64
  • Virtual Machine Platform needs to be enabled
